Welcome to Hickory Hill ...

Hickory Hill is located in Cole County<1>.


We aren't confident of the location of Hickory Hill, so consider the above location as an estimate.<2>


While we don't have a date for the founding of Hickory Hill, you might consider that their post office opened  in 1839.

Hickory Hill is 880 feet [268 m] above sea level.<3>.

Time Zone: Hickory Hill lies in the Central Time Zone (CST/CDT) and observes daylight saving time

The telephone area code for Hickory Hill: (573)

Adding Hickory Hill to Our Gazetteer ...

We originally found mention of Hickory Hill in both the FIPS-55 and the GNIS. For more information, see the FIPS and GNIS Codes sections on our Miscellaneous Page.

From our notes, the earliest published mention we've found for Hickory Hill was in the document titled List of Post Offices from Cameron Blevins and Richard Helbock.<6>

From that list, the Hickory Hill post office opened in 1839.

We also found Hickory Hill in the book titled U.S. Post Offices (Oct. 1846).
